85% of Families of People with Disabilities in Japan Anxious About Future “After Parents Are Gone” [Podcast Episode]

The online survey was conducted by the Nippon Foundation last October targeting 2,500 family members of people with disabilities. Overall, 36.2% said they were “very anxious” about the future, 27.6% “anxious,” and 21.7% “slightly anxious.”
